Idaho’s South Central health district shows jump in coronavirus cases; death toll unchanged

The South Central Public Health District accounted for 17 of the 24 new confirmed cases of the coronavirus that were reported Thursday in Idaho.

After reporting just two on Wednesday, Twin Falls County led the state with eight new cases. With 286 confirmed cases, it trails only Ada (739) and Blaine (499) among the hardest-hit counties in the state, according to case counts posted by the state’s seven health districts.

No new coronavirus-related deaths were reported Thursday, which left the statewide death toll at 77. The number of confirmed cases in Idaho stands at 2,305.

The counties that reported news cases on Thursday were Twin Falls (8 new, 286 total), Jerome (3 new, 94 total), Canyon (3 new, 263 total), Gooding (2 new, 26 total), Minidoka (2 new, 21 total), Ada (1 new, 739 total), Blaine (1 new, 499 total), Cassia (1 new, 20 total), Gem (1 new, 13 total), Owyhee (1 new, 9 total) and Payette (1 new, 19 total).

There are 233 “probable cases” throughout the state, an increase of five from Tuesday. The Idaho Department of Health and Welfare reports that 1,720 cases are “presumed recovered.”

DAILY DETAILS

Hospitalizations: Health and Welfare reports that there have been 223 hospitalizations due to the coronavirus, 92 admissions to the ICU and 298 health care workers who have been infected. The hospital and health care numbers are based on cases with completed investigations into contacts, not the full number of positives.

Testing totals: At the end of the day Tuesday, Health and Welfare reported that 39,362 tests had been completed statewide. About 5.9% have been positive for COVID-19. According to IDHW, the state conducted its second-most tests last week with 5,207. That trails only March 29-April 4, when the state conducted 5,582.
